2025 Independent Practitioner Fellowship

Dated: December 30, 2024

The Independent Practitioner Fellowship supports practitioners in their individual work with the goal of strengthening and enriching the humanities community in the city.

Donor Name: HumanitiesDC

City: Washington D.C.

Type of Grant: Fellowship

Deadline: 01/17/2025

Size of the Grant: $1000 to $10,000

Grant Duration: Less than 1 Year

Details:

Additionally, this program provides resources to individuals who do not always have the opportunity to engage in the humanities as a career or passion. They are looking for individuals who are independently pursuing humanities-based projects with the goal of strengthening and enriching the humanities community in the city.

The Independent Practitioner Fellowship provides support to public humanities practitioners whose voices and perspectives strengthen the humanities landscape in Washington, DC.

Funding Information

Fellows receive a $10,000 award and meet monthly as a cohort for professional development and peer support opportunities.

Fellowship Period

March 10, 2025 to January 2, 2026.

Allowable Costs

These funds are intended to support the practitioner during the Fellowship, so salary for the practitioner is expected to be the primary or sole expense. However, applicants can include other expenses such as supplies, equipment, travel, and facilities rental that would support their stated Fellowship goals.

Eligibility Requirements

At the time of submission, applicants must meet all the following eligibility requirements:

  • Be a District of Columbia resident with a permanent District of Columbia address, as listed on government-issued identification or tax returns. Post office boxes and UPS addresses may not be used as permanent addresses.
  • Be a public humanities practitioner, defined as someone engaged in bringing the ideas of the humanities to life for general audiences.
  • Be at least 18 years old.
  • Submit a Certificate of Clean Hands (CCH) from the District of Columbia Office of Tax and Revenue.
  • Be in good standing with HumanitiesDC. Applicants with outstanding or delinquent reports or final products from previous HumanitiesDC grants must submit them completed and without deficiencies at least 30 days before the deadline for which they wish to apply.
  • Not be an individual grantee of HumanitiesDC during the period of the Fellowship.
  • Not have received Federal funds for the same or overlapping project period and purpose as this request.
